CAN YOU WELD THE TA SOLID OR BOLT THE FLYWHEEL SOLID TO CLUTCH SOME HOW OR WHAT KIND OF A JOB IS IT TO INSTALL A TA DELETE KIT HAVE THE TRACTOR SPLIT RIGHT NOW AND WAS NEEDING SOME HELP,THANKS GUYS HAVE A GOOD DAY HOPE YOU DONT HAVE TO USE A SNOW SHOVEL,
 
You may want to repair it. (I know that is not what you asked) they are fine parts of the tractor.
If pulling only in classes that do not allow TA use, the easiest method would be to put a new disk in the TA and not reconnect the external linkage.
If you are putting twice the power through the TA, a TA eliminator kit is best. If you weld the internal components you will have slag and beads of metal floating around in the trans, and no assurance that it will hold the power. It could be disassembled to get to the planetary gear set, and welded on the bench with professional level welding practices, cleaned and reassembled. Jim

What is the purpose of bolting the clutch disk to the flywheel?
 
I think he means that he could bolt the TA clutch disk to the TA housing or (better) the TA pressure plate, then it would be locked up. I see no problem with that, it would take at least six 1/4X20 flat head grade 5 bolts around the perimeter.
